I've recently started using QuEnc for some of my encodings to SVCD. Works great. However, when multiplexing the video produced with the audio using mplex, there's a ton of underflow errors. Is that something to worry about? Seems to play fine on the PC, and the little clip I tried on the standalone also seemed to play fine. Haven't tried with a complete movie though...

My encodes play fine as well, but playing and being error free valid streams is another thing. I've been having alot of issues with my encodes, gop errors in Tmpenc Author, weird frames inserted into the stream, and other weird phenomena. Chances are these are all pre 1.0 bugs, and will hopefully be fixed, but for now I would suggest switching to another encoder, I'm looking for a replacement as well unfortunately, and I say unfortunately because I love the libavcodec, best quality encoder I've seen to date.
